REX Dollhouse for Calvin Klein

“By treating a New York street like landscape—and Calvin Klein’s storefront like a New York street—we created a detached single-family dollhouse in Manhattan for the Calvin Klein woman,” said architect Prince-Ramus. “Undeniably frivolous, the ‘Madison Avenue (Doll)House’ still suggests a kernel of an idea for accommodating growth in existing population centers.” -REX

Unplugged! High Desert Test Sites

UNPLUGGED: Ecoshack’s design lab will feature experimental work from the SCI-Arc design studio “Unplugged: Off-the-Grid Experiments in Architecture” during HDTS/CA Biennial in Joshua Tree, CA on Saturday Nov 8, 10am to 5pm. Frank Gehry in Tokyo

Frank Gehry has designed an interesting one-off furniture piece being unveiled at Tokyo Design Week. This piece is the visitors bench for the World Company building – home to over 90 fashion labels and 3000+ retail outlets.

Oyler Wu Installation at SCI-Arc

Oyler Wu Collaborative has done an interesting installation at the SCI-Arc gallery titled “Live Wire.” Here is a collection of images from the opening. It drew a nice crowd while there seemed to be a 10 foot radius around the installation at all times.
